Germany’s Greens name Annalena Baerbock as chancellor candidate Kate Connolly in Berlin © Provided by The Guardian Photograph: Getty Images Germany’s Green party has named its co-chair Annalena Baerbock as candidate for chancellor in autumn’s federal election, as the party rides high in the polls and the ruling conservative bloc squabbles over its own choice to succeed Angela Merkel. Baerbock, 40, viewed as a tenacious, down-to earth centrist with an eye for detail, and an expert on climate change and how to tackle it, told a small party gathering she aimed to “make politics for society at large”. She described her candidacy as “an offer, an invitation to lead our diverse, prosperous, strong country into a good future”.

The National publishes censored blog which made the case for independence

THE National is today publishing a report that Downing Street definitely doesn’t want you to see. The article, originally published on the London School of Economics (LSE) British Politics and Policy blog, concludes that Scotland can be economically successful after independence. Co-authored by a UK Government adviser, it was mysteriously deleted on April 1, shortly after The National published a story about it. On April 2, a message appeared on the LSE website stating: “We have been asked by the authors to take this article down temporarily. We will be making it available again as soon as we are able to and apologise for any inconvenience caused.”
